Course Content

• Advanced Mass Spectrometry for Proteomics
• Protein Identification and Quantification using Bioinformatics
• Proteome Profiling: Experimental Design and Data Analysis
• Post-translational Modifications and their Analysis
• Advanced Peptide Separation Techniques (e.g., 2D-LC)
• Label-free and Isobaric Quantitative Proteomics
• Statistical Analysis and Data Visualization in Proteomics
• Proteomics in Disease Mechanisms and Biomarker Discovery
• Ethical Considerations and Data Management in Proteomics Research

Career path

Career Role (Proteome Profiling) Description
Bioinformatics Scientist (Proteomics) Analyze large proteomic datasets, develop algorithms for data analysis, and contribute to proteome research projects. High demand for expertise in bioinformatics and proteomics data analysis.
Proteomics Research Scientist Conduct independent research projects focusing on proteome profiling techniques, data interpretation, and scientific publications. Requires strong research skills and experience in mass spectrometry and protein identification.
Clinical Proteomics Specialist Apply proteome profiling techniques to clinical diagnostics and biomarker discovery. Involves collaborating with clinicians, interpreting results and contributing to the development of new diagnostic tools.
Proteomics Laboratory Manager Manage and oversee proteomics laboratories, including instrument maintenance, staff training, and project management. Requires experience in laboratory management, proteomics techniques, and team leadership.
